    I removed front tire to paint the front fender and the bolts that attach fender to forks won't thread right. One side goes in fine other side threads at an angle and Idk y since this is first bike its a 98 katana 600 plz help me out I'm ready to ride thanks

  • #2
    You've got the bolt cross-threaded and have mangled the threads a little. Try backing the bolt out all the way and keep turning it counter-clockwise with a little pressure until you feel the bolt click in a little. That's your sign that you've got the threads lined up right and you can start the bolt (turning it by hand) until you've got it most of the way in. Then finish tightening it with a wrench.

    If that doesn't work you can try straightening out the threads by running the bolt through from the opposite side.
